A local mental health charity is seeking a Safeguarding Officer in Bath. This fixed-term role involves overseeing safeguarding practices, supporting vulnerable young people, and ensuring compliance with statutory requirements.

The candidate should have experience in safeguarding, a collaborative mindset, and the ability to work with various stakeholders. This position requires some evening/weekend work and will enhance the safeguarding systems within the organization.

How to prepare for a job interview at Bath and North East Somerset Council

✨Know Your Safeguarding Stuff

Make sure you brush up on the latest safeguarding practices and statutory requirements. Be ready to discuss specific examples from your experience where you've successfully implemented these practices, as this will show your expertise and commitment to youth wellbeing.

✨Show Your Collaborative Spirit

This role requires working with various stakeholders, so be prepared to share instances where you've collaborated effectively in the past. Highlight your ability to build relationships and work as part of a team, as this will demonstrate that you're a good fit for their culture.

✨Flexibility is Key

Since the position involves some evening and weekend work, be upfront about your availability. Show that you're adaptable and willing to go the extra mile when it comes to supporting vulnerable young people, as this will reflect your dedication to the role.

✨Prepare Questions That Matter

Think of insightful questions to ask during the interview that show your genuine interest in the charity's mission and safeguarding systems. This could include asking about their current challenges or how they measure success in their safeguarding practices, which will help you stand out as an engaged candidate.
